Decoding the 78M12 Datasheet’s Secrets
The 78M12 datasheet is essentially a comprehensive manual for a three-terminal positive voltage regulator. These regulators are designed to provide a stable and consistent output voltage, even when the input voltage fluctuates or the load current changes. Think of it as a tiny powerhouse ensuring your sensitive electronic components always receive the correct amount of power. The datasheet outlines all the vital parameters, including:
- Input voltage range (typically 14.5V to 30V)
- Output voltage (precisely 12V)
- Maximum output current (usually around 500mA)
- Thermal resistance (crucial for heat management)
Understanding these parameters is critical for designing robust and reliable circuits. Ignoring the datasheet’s specifications can lead to overheating, component failure, or unpredictable circuit behavior.

Here is a small table summarizing important parameters:
| Parameter | Typical Value |
|---|---|
| Output Voltage | 12V |
| Input Voltage Range | 14.5V - 30V |
| Output Current | 500mA |
